Which technique is used to estimate project costs?
Parametric Estimating In parametric estimating, historical data and statistical modeling are used to assign a dollar value to certain project costs. This approach determines the underlying unit cost for a particular component of a project and then sales that unit cost as appropriate.

What are the four methods of cost estimation?
The four major analytical methods or cost estimation techniques used to develop cost estimates for acquisition programs are Analogy, Parametric (Statistical), Engineering (Bottoms Up), and Actual Costs.

What are the five basic parameters that are involved in estimating the cost of a software project?
Most software cost models can be abstracted into a function of five basic parameters: size, process, personnel, environment, and required quality.
